    3. Hi, I'm new to the list and I would appreciate some help on this one. Minnie Burns married Charles Seaton. She was born 1889 Ontario, Canada and died 1918 in Detroit, Michigan. I have the following obit for her: Obituary: Chatham Daily Planet 4 Dec 1918 Page 4 BIRTHS, MARRIAGES, DEATHS SEATON: In Detroit, Michigan, on Tuesday December 3, 1918, Minnie Seaton, aged 29 years, 5 months and 11 days, daughter of Mr. and Mrs. J. Burns, Forest Ave. Detroit, Michigan. The funeral will take place from the Grand Trunk Station on Thursday, December 5, at 1:45, thence to Maple Leaf Cemetery where internment will take place. I had someone try and find her gravesite, but couldn't. Is there any transcript of Maple Leaf Cemetery where I could find out just where she is buried? I do know that Charles and his second wife are buried there and they have markers, but don't know about Minnie. Also, if there are any of the Burns family buried in the same cemetery. Thanks. Pat

Hi Pat, The only SEATONs listed are : Angeline & Enoch Bertha & Charles Clara If they are not listed in the OCFA they were not transcribed [due to no marker] Are the BURNS you are seeking in the OCFA? There are 10 BURNS in Maple Leaf cemetery. OCFA website is < http://www.islandnet.com/ocfa/ > Maple Leaf cemetery is about 400-500 acres so would need given names.
